The labour community in the Region of Peel invites workers, worker representatives and others to register for occupational health and safety training opportunities this October.
The Workers Health & Safety Centre's (WHSC) three hour Workplace Violence program is being offered by Labour Community Services of Peel on Thursday, October 8. This program explores all aspects of workplace violence including verbal and physical abuse and harassment. Also discussed is the development and implementation of an effective workplace violence prevention program.
The Brampton-Mississauga and District Labour Council has scheduled the WHSC Federal Level I Occupational Health & Safety Training program for October 13 through October 16. This program is designed to provide workers and their representatives with a general understanding of occupational health and safety including hazard awareness, principles for controlling exposure along with occupational health and safety law. Equally important, participants are encouraged to lead or get more involved in health, safety and environmental efforts in their workplace, union and community. Some graduates may become health and safety representatives or joint health and safety committee members. Others may go on to become WHSC-trained volunteer instructors. It is hoped all will make a positive contribution towards safer and healthier work environments.
